This group, which consists of seven members, was started in November 2017. The members are experienced in the businesses they operate and share strong bonds of solidarity. They live in the same village and their main business is market gardening.
Madam Khady, who is on the right side of the picture with her hand raised, is the leader of the group. She is 62 years old and operates a market garden. She grows onions and sweet potatoes. After the harvest, she retails the products in her neighbourhood.
This funding will enable her to buy nursery stock in the fields located in the village and to develop her business. She wants to use the profits from her sales to help her husband and her children meet the daily expenses.
